Help - Everything is UPside Down on my Screen

I haven't got a clue what is going on. Absolutely everything is upside down on the monitor/display screen. All icons, task bar - everything is in the wrong place. As I am typing, everything is upside down.

How can I fix it please. My pc is using windows 10. It recently updated a few days ago. Has been working fine but now it is upside down.

Please help. Thankyou.

Comments

  • try pressing "CTRL + ALT + arrow key" (i think up arrow)
